Altair: A Record of Battles 15
The land of Cielo is now Torqye's first satellite territory! Following the Imperial fleet's defeat in L'isolani at the hands of Venedik commander Lucio, Mahmut's victory in Cielo once again sets the gears of history in motion. With Balt-Rhein left licking its wounds, Zaganos advances his forces in hopes of injecting his "poison" into Imperial lands! His next stop: the Empier vassal of Printemps, where he hopes to knock Balt-Rhein's legs out from under them!
